Middleware to warstwa pośrednia między systemami, która tłumaczy i przekazuje dane bez konieczności bezpośredniego połączenia każdej pary aplikacji. W integracji e-commerce middleware łączy ERP z OMS, sklepem i marketplace — jeden hub komunikacyjny zastępuje dziesiątki pojedynczych połączeń.
Zasada działania middleware w integracji systemów
Middleware działa jako translator między różnymi systemami — pobiera dane z jednego źródła, przekształca je do wymaganego formatu i przekazuje do docelowej aplikacji. Zamiast budować 6 połączeń dla 3 systemów (każdy z każdym), middleware tworzy 3 połączenia do centralnego huba. BPA Platform, którą wykorzystujemy w projektach Orbis, obsługuje ponad 40 różnych systemów — od Subiekt GT po Amazon FBA. Pojedyncza instancja middleware może równocześnie synchronizować produkty z ERP do sklepu, zamówienia ze sklepu do OMS i stany magazynowe z powrotem do wszystkich kanałów sprzedaży.
Korzyści z zastosowania warstwy pośredniej
Middleware eliminuje problem eksplozji połączeń — firma z 5 systemami potrzebuje tylko 5 integracji zamiast 20. Centralna warstwa pośrednia ułatwia monitoring przepływu danych, logowanie błędów i wprowadzanie zmian. Gdy dodajesz nowy kanał sprzedaży, wystarczy jedna integracja z middleware, a nie oddzielne połączenia z ERP, OMS i systemem magazynowym. W praktyce Orbis — klient z Subiekt GT i BaseLinker może w 2 tygodnie dodać Allegro i Amazon, bo middleware już "zna" struktury danych obu systemów.
Middleware vs bezpośrednie integracje punktowe
Bezpośrednie integracje punktowe (system A → system B) działają sprawnie dla 2-3 aplikacji, ale stają się problematyczne przy większej liczbie systemów. Każda zmiana w jednym systemie wymaga modyfikacji wszystkich połączonych integracji. Middleware rozwiązuje ten problem poprzez standaryzację — wszystkie systemy "rozmawiają" tym samym językiem z warstwą pośrednią. BPA Platform oferuje gotowe konektory do najpopularniejszych systemów e-commerce, co skraca czas implementacji z miesięcy do tygodni. Dodatkowo middleware zapewnia buforowanie danych, kolejkowanie operacji i automatyczne ponowienie nieudanych transferów.
Przykład implementacji middleware w firmie e-commerce
Sklep internetowy z 4 systemami (Subiekt GT, Shoper, Allegro, magazyn WMS) bez middleware potrzebuje 6 integracji punktowych. Z middleware — tylko 4 połączenia do centralnego huba. Gdy firma dodaje Amazon i Sellasist, liczba integracji punktowych wzrasta do 15, a z middleware — do 6. Oszczędność czasu implementacji przekracza 60%, a koszty utrzymania spadają proporcjonalnie.
Middleware to inwestycja w skalowalność systemów e-commerce. Pojedyncza warstwa pośrednia eliminuje chaos połączeń punktowych i przyspiesza rozwój technologiczny firmy.
Potrzebujesz pomocy z implementacją middleware? Umów bezpłatną konsultację — w 30 minut pokażemy, jak możemy to rozwiązać w Twojej firmie.
